excel怎么计算小计

excel怎么计算小计

在Excel中计算小计的方法有多种,最常用的包括使用函数、数据透视表、以及自动筛选功能。这些方法各有优劣,适用于不同的场景。 使用函数可以快速计算特定列或行的小计、数据透视表提供了更为灵活和动态的分析方式、而自动筛选功能则在快速筛选和计算特定条件下的小计时非常有用。下面将详细介绍每种方法的具体步骤和应用场景。

一、使用函数计算小计

1、SUM函数

SUM函数是Excel中最基本的求和函数,它可以用来计算某一列或某一行的总和。

使用步骤:

  1. 选择一个单元格,输入 =SUM(
  2. 选择需要求和的单元格范围,例如 A1:A10
  3. 输入右括号 ) 并按下回车键。

示例

假设你有一个数据表,其中A列是销售额,你可以在B1单元格输入 =SUM(A1:A10) 来计算前十行的销售额总和。

2、SUBTOTAL函数

SUBTOTAL函数比SUM函数更为灵活,它不仅能计算总和,还能进行平均、计数等多种操作。

使用步骤:

  1. 选择一个单元格,输入 =SUBTOTAL(
  2. 输入函数代码,例如 9 表示求和, 1 表示平均。
  3. 选择需要计算的单元格范围,例如 A1:A10
  4. 输入右括号 ) 并按下回车键。

示例

在B1单元格输入 =SUBTOTAL(9, A1:A10) 来计算前十行的销售额总和。

二、使用数据透视表计算小计

数据透视表是Excel中非常强大的分析工具,它不仅可以计算小计,还可以进行复杂的数据分析和报表生成。

1、创建数据透视表

使用步骤:

  1. 选择数据区域,点击“插入”选项卡。
  2. 点击“数据透视表”按钮。
  3. 在弹出的对话框中选择数据源和放置位置,然后点击“确定”。

2、配置数据透视表

使用步骤:

  1. 在数据透视表字段列表中,将需要计算的小计字段拖动到“值”区域。
  2. 如果需要按某一字段分组计算小计,可以将该字段拖动到“行”或“列”区域。
  3. 数据透视表会自动生成小计和总计。

示例

假设你有一个销售数据表,其中包含“销售员”、“产品”、“销售额”等字段。你可以创建一个数据透视表,将“销售员”拖动到行区域,将“销售额”拖动到值区域,这样就可以看到每个销售员的销售额小计和总计。

三、使用自动筛选功能计算小计

自动筛选功能可以快速筛选出符合条件的数据,并计算这些数据的小计。

1、启用自动筛选

使用步骤:

  1. 选择数据区域,点击“数据”选项卡。
  2. 点击“筛选”按钮,数据表格顶部会出现筛选箭头。

2、筛选数据并计算小计

使用步骤:

  1. 点击列标题中的筛选箭头,选择需要筛选的条件。
  2. 筛选后,使用SUM或SUBTOTAL函数计算筛选结果的小计。

示例

假设你有一个数据表,其中包含“地区”、“销售额”等字段。你可以启用自动筛选功能,筛选出某个地区的数据,然后在筛选结果下方使用 =SUBTOTAL(9, B2:B20) 计算该地区的销售额小计。

四、使用条件格式和自定义公式计算小计

有时候你可能需要更复杂的计算,例如根据多个条件计算小计,这时可以使用条件格式和自定义公式。

1、使用SUMIF函数

SUMIF函数可以根据单一条件计算小计。

使用步骤:

  1. 选择一个单元格,输入 =SUMIF(
  2. 输入条件范围,例如 A1:A10
  3. 输入条件,例如 "北区"
  4. 输入求和范围,例如 B1:B10
  5. 输入右括号 ) 并按下回车键。

示例

在C1单元格输入 =SUMIF(A1:A10, "北区", B1:B10) 来计算北区的销售额小计。

2、使用SUMIFS函数

SUMIFS函数可以根据多个条件计算小计。

使用步骤:

  1. 选择一个单元格,输入 =SUMIFS(
  2. 输入求和范围,例如 B1:B10
  3. 输入条件范围1,例如 A1:A10
  4. 输入条件1,例如 "北区"
  5. 输入条件范围2,例如 C1:C10
  6. 输入条件2,例如 "产品A"
  7. 输入右括号 ) 并按下回车键。

示例

在D1单元格输入 =SUMIFS(B1:B10, A1:A10, "北区", C1:C10, "产品A") 来计算北区产品A的销售额小计。

五、使用数组公式计算小计

数组公式是Excel中高级的计算方法,可以进行复杂的数据处理和计算。

1、使用数组公式求和

使用步骤:

  1. 选择一个单元格,输入公式 =SUM(
  2. 输入数组公式,例如 {A1:A10 * B1:B10}
  3. 输入右括号 ) 并按下回车键,同时按下 Ctrl+Shift+Enter

示例

在E1单元格输入 =SUM(A1:A10 * B1:B10) 并按下 Ctrl+Shift+Enter 来计算两个数组的乘积和。

六、使用动态数组公式计算小计

Excel 365和Excel 2019引入了动态数组公式,可以更加灵活地处理数据。

1、使用FILTER函数

FILTER函数可以根据条件筛选数据,并返回一个数组。

使用步骤:

  1. 选择一个单元格,输入 =FILTER(
  2. 输入数据范围,例如 A1:A10
  3. 输入条件,例如 B1:B10 > 100
  4. 输入右括号 ) 并按下回车键。

示例

在F1单元格输入 =FILTER(A1:A10, B1:B10 > 100) 来筛选出销售额大于100的行。

2、使用SEQUENCE函数

SEQUENCE函数可以生成一个连续的数字序列,用于动态计算。

使用步骤:

  1. 选择一个单元格,输入 =SEQUENCE(
  2. 输入行数,例如 10
  3. 输入列数,例如 1
  4. 输入起始值,例如 1
  5. 输入增量值,例如 1
  6. 输入右括号 ) 并按下回车键。

示例

在G1单元格输入 =SEQUENCE(10, 1, 1, 1) 来生成一个从1到10的连续数字序列。

七、总结

在Excel中计算小计的方法多种多样,选择合适的方法可以提高工作效率和数据分析的准确性。无论是使用简单的SUM函数,还是复杂的数组公式,或者是灵活的数据透视表和自动筛选功能,都可以根据具体的需求进行选择和应用。希望本文能够为你提供有价值的参考,帮助你在Excel中更好地进行数据处理和分析。

相关问答FAQs:

1. 如何在Excel中计算小计?
在Excel中,您可以使用“数据透视表”功能来计算小计。首先,选择您要进行小计的数据范围。然后,转到“插入”选项卡,点击“数据透视表”。在弹出的对话框中,选择您的数据范围,并将其拖放到“行”和“值”区域中。在“值”区域中选择您想要计算小计的字段,并选择“小计”选项。最后,点击“确定”按钮,Excel将自动计算小计并将其显示在您选择的位置。

2. 如何在Excel中对数据进行分组并计算小计?
如果您想要按照某个特定的字段对数据进行分组并计算小计,您可以使用“数据透视表”功能。首先,选择您的数据范围,并转到“插入”选项卡,点击“数据透视表”。在弹出的对话框中,选择您的数据范围,并将其拖放到“行”和“值”区域中。然后,在“行”区域中选择您想要按照的字段,并将其拖放到“列”区域中。最后,选择“小计”选项并点击“确定”按钮,Excel将根据您选择的字段对数据进行分组并计算小计。

3. 如何在Excel中使用公式计算小计?
除了使用“数据透视表”功能外,您还可以使用Excel的公式来计算小计。假设您的数据范围在A1:A10,您可以使用SUMIF函数来计算小计。在B1单元格中输入以下公式:=SUMIF(A1:A10,A1,B1)。然后,将B1单元格拖放到B2:B10单元格,Excel将自动计算并显示小计。请确保在公式中正确引用您的数据范围和要计算小计的字段。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4102075

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部